    1) fist of awesome - best on iOS. Gameplay, humor, graphics, and even a cool story that includes big ass beards, gratuitous bear nudity, time travel, homoeroticism, cannibalism, and punching a shit ton wildlife.
    2) big action mega fight - it's initials say it all: B.A.M.F.!
    3) beatdown - this is a ravenous title that I rarely hear anyone praise, but I love it.
    4) Nakama - a crescent moon release that people either love or hate. I love it. There's a free version to try.
    5) Mutant Fridge Mayhem - another great CN game, that has a ton of charm

    Honorable Mention goes to the Zombieville USA series
    It uses guns, but still plays very much like a Beat em Up.
